Decoding the Volvo EC290's Powerful Engine Control Unit
The Volvo EC290 is renowned for its powerful performance, a quality directly attributed como lacro ecu do volvo d13 to its sophisticated Engine Control Unit (ECU). This advanced electronic system serves as the controller of the machine, meticulously optimizing numerous vital parameters to ensure optimal power delivery and fuel efficiency.
The EC290's ECU employs cutting-edge algorithms to monitor a vast array of real-time data, including engine speed, load, temperature, and hydraulic pressure. Based on this information, the ECU precisely adjusts parameters such as fuel injection timing, turbocharger boost, and hydraulic flow to achieve optimal performance in any given situation.
This intricate system allows operators to experience seamless power delivery, smooth operation, and reduced fuel consumption. By understanding the workings of the EC290's powerful ECU, we can gain a deeper appreciation into the machine's remarkable capabilities.
Identifying Volvo Excavators: VECU Diagnostics and Solutions
When a modern excavator starts exhibiting issues, it can quickly stall productivity. Luckily, the Vehicle Electronic Control Unit (VECU) provides invaluable clues into potential reasons. Utilizing specialized diagnostic tools and procedures, technicians can identify faults within the VECU system and implement effective solutions. This process often involves analyzing fault codes, monitoring sensor data, and performing tests on various components.
- Typical VECU issues can include powertrain system errors, communication glitches with other vehicle modules, and input discrepancies.
- Proper VECU resolution often requires a combination of technical knowledge, experience with Volvo excavators, and proficiency in using diagnostic software.
- Make certain to consult the official Volvo service manual for specific guidelines related to your particular excavator model and VECU system.
By familiarizing oneself with VECU diagnostics, technicians can effectively identify and address issues, minimizing downtime and maximizing the operational efficiency of Volvo excavators.
